American Idol Top 11

Like I said, last week was crazy so I never got around to doing this week's review.  Wow, what a week! The judges used their one save of the season (not happy about it), and Hulk Hogan was on.  Definitely did not see that coming.  The theme this week was Motown, and for the most part the contestants did a pretty good job.  

Scotty McCreery

Scotty was amazing!  Once again he delivered another strong performance and really entertained the crowd.  I think this was the week that would test Scotty and prove to America if he could really win this competition.  It was the first week where Scotty had to leave his comfort zone, but he took a Stevie Wonder song and turned it into a country hit.  I truly believe Scotty could win this whole competition.

Paul McDonald

Paul sang 'Tracks of My Tears' (a song that Adam did back in Season 8 in a beautiful acoustic rendition) with his guitar, but it was just okay.  He seemed a little shaky and wasn't up to par.  I hope he really finds his comfort zone on the show soon so that he can really flourish.  I love him, but it feels like he is being swallowed up in the competition.

Thia Megia

I was really disappointed this week.  Thia finally picked an upbeat song, but it was really boring.  She needs to do a better uptempo song that is more well-known and recent that she could have more fun with.  She just seems bored up there, and that is probably what will kill her in the long-run.  She is more a contemporary singer and the themes on the show just don't help that kind of singer.  Let's hope for a better week this week.

Lauren Alaina

Again, Lauren is back!  Another great performance.  She is really starting to come into her own and deliver the strong performances that she showed us in the audition round.  Let's hope for more success from Lauren in the weeks to come!

I was really upset that they saved Casey this week: this is exactly why I hate the save.  It's simply a way to add "drama" to show.  Casey was eliminated for a reason: he had the lowest number of votes so he does not belong on the show.  America votes and they made their decision.  Hopefully he'll just be kicked off next week.  And like I've said before, James Durbin needs to stop screaming.  It's getting on my nerves.
